A smaller triangle is cut out of a larger triangle. The larger triangle is a right triangle with side lengths of 5 millimeters and 12 millimeters. The smaller triangle has side lengths of 4 millimeters and 3 millimeters.
What is the area of the shaded region?

21 mm2
24 mm2
42 mm2
48 mm2

Larger triangle area = 1/2 · 5 · 12 = 30 mm^2.
Smaller triangle area = 1/2 · 3 · 4 = 6 mm^2.
Shaded area = 30 − 6 = 24 mm^2.

Answer: 24 mm^2.
